TRANSIT.ion

The theater company Pan.Optikum from Germany is renowned for its productions with impressive scenographies, made on a large scale, which are spectacular from a visual point of view. Starting from

the notion “people always look for happiness and they find war”, the show TRANSIT.ion is inspired from the play “The Sun and the Death” written by Lebanese writer Wajdi Mouawad. With a team made of thirty actors, dancers, musicians, artists, and technicians, the production TRANSIT.ion resorts to aerial acrobatics, light shows, fire, and fireworks in order to create a visual parable of the contemporary society.

Grand Nocturnal Aquatic Parade

Carnival on water with surrealist scenes which promise to impress the public with the actors’ light and fire game, with cars on water, floating islands, cages, animals, and fantastic characters. From Sydney to Chicago, Seoul or London to the swamps of Camargue or the harbor-towns in Russia, French company Ilotopie has the reputation of turning rivers, lakes, and docks into fluid scenes for spectacular theater productions in the open air, with a strong visual impact.

Hotel Watercage

A 50-minute trip to a surrealist dimension in which the main characters of Hotel Watercage are in a perpetual quest for happiness. Entrapped in cages or suspended above the crowds, they go farther and farther from the surrounding reality. Accompanied by opera singers and live music, the dwellers of Watercage Hotel fight in order to free themselves from their own thoughts and to distance themselves from the past in a show of aerial acrobatics full of poetry.

Eterfeel

Created by Argentinean director Roberto Strada, the night show combines aerial acrobatics with the light show. 12 acrobats build a hypnotic universe on a high metallic structure turned into one of the most spectacular vertical stages of street theater.
